From 7b390888fd9f3886d966ab072c328f4fbd9c64b4 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Robert Grosse Date: Thu, 25 Jul 2013 14:34:41 -0700 Subject: Add a -finstrument-functions-size=n option to control basic block filtering. If omitted entirely, the original behavior is restored. This also undos the string and __pnacl_profile stuff from the previous CL. Finally, it fixes and updates the -finstrument-function tests.
